Ordinals
beta
Sat 631076951610586
decimal
21235.48151610586
percentile
1.2621539032211722%
name
mkrrnmubqkxb
cycle
0
epoch
2
block
21235
offset
48151610586
timestamp
2023-12-24 04:57:45 UTC
rarity
common
prev
next